It will be much easier to remove the chicken after processing. WebDrain and squeeze meat to remove excess moisture. Fill half-pint jars with 6 ounces of meat and pint jars with 12 ounces, leaving 1-inch headspace. Add 1/2 teaspoon of citric acid or 2 tablespoons of lemon juice to each half-pint jar, or 1 teaspoon of citric acid or 4 tablespoons of lemon juice per pint jar. Add hot water, leaving 1-inch headspace.

Mason jars make great measuring “cups”. 1 cup = 1/2 pint jar cups = pint jar 4 cups = quart jar 8 cups = half gallon jar. What is the most common size of Mason jar? The most common sizes are the half-pint, pint, and quart. A pint is the equivalent of two cups, or 16 ounces. WebProcessing times have not been developed for many foods in half-pint, 12-ounce or 24-ounce (one and one-half pint jars.) If the recipe does not specify processing in one of these jars, process half-pint and 12-ounce jars for the same time as pints.
